Kyrenia

Kyrenia

Kyrenia is the principal port of the Turkish Republic of Northern Cyprus, (Kerinis; Turkish Girne). Kyrenia, is picturesquely situated on the flanks of the Pentadaktylos Mountain Range.

The beautiful Kyrenia coastline combines natural unspoiled beauty with a rich and varied history. This is why Kyrenia is one of the most picturesque towns in the Mediterranean.

Harbor at Kyrenia  still retains its original character, and is dominated by an imposing 7th century castle which houses the famous Shipwreck Museum.

In Kyrenia museum, you can see the cargo of the ancient shipwreck recovered. This is believed to have been sunk about one mile from Kyrenia Harbor, in the year 300BC.

Charming Kyrenia harbor is now the ideal place to slow down to the relaxing Mediterranean pace, and watch life go by from one of the harbor cafes or restaurants, which offer something for everyone.

For those with an eye for the cultural excellence, a visit to Bellapais Abbey in Kyrenia will offer unforgettable moments.
